现在参与一个项目的开发,需要用java查询mongodb数据库,在这里分页用的skipsort和limit结合,查询语句如下(已经在相关字段建立索引)DBCursorcursor=collection.find(query).skip((skip-1)*PAGESIZE).sort(newBasicDBObject("starttime",-1)).limit(PAGESIZE);//PAGESIZE=10由于分页,这里需获取符合条件的总数语句如下intc
系统 2019-08-12 01:53:07 2316
一、相关概念和知识点1.数据依赖:反映一个关系内部属性与属性之间的约束关系,是现实世界属性间相互联系的抽象,属于数据内在的性质和语义的体现。2.规范化理论:是用来设计良好的关系模式的基本理论。它通过分解关系模式来消除其中不合适的数据依赖,以解决插入异常、删除异常、更新异常和数据冗余问题。3.函数依赖:简单地说,对于关系模式的两个属性子集X和Y,若X的任一取值能唯一确定Y的值,则称Y函数依赖于X,记作X→Y。4.非平凡函数依赖:对于关系模式的两个属性子集X和
系统 2019-08-12 01:52:22 2316
--期初数据DECLARE@stockTABLE(idint,numdecimal(10,2))INSERT@stockSELECT1,100UNIONALLSELECT3,500UNIONALLSELECT4,800--入库数据DECLARE@inTABLE(idint,numdecimal(10,2))INSERT@inSELECT1,100UNIONALLSELECT1,80UNIONALLSELECT2,800--出库数据DECLARE@outTA
系统 2019-08-12 01:51:36 2316
AHOI彩旗飘飘这是一题类似于排列组合的题目吧...递推状态数组f[100][100][100][2];表示红旗数目,黄旗数目,颜色改变的次数,末尾的旗的颜色(0为黄,1为红)之后就是如何写递推式了:for(intk=2;k<=m;k++)for(inti=1;i<=n;i++)for(intj=1;j<=n;j++){for(intl=1;l<=i;l++){f[i][j][k][0]+=f[i-l][j][k-1][1];}for(intl=1;l<=
系统 2019-08-12 01:33:00 2316
原文:ActiveReports9实战教程(1):手把手搭建环境VisualStudio2013社区版ActiveReports9刚刚发布3天,微软就发布了VisualStudioCommunity2013开发环境。VisualStudioCommunity2013提供完整功能的IDE,可开发Windows、Android和iOS应用。支持:C++,Python,HTML5,JavaScript,和C#,VB,F#语言的开发,提供设计器、编辑器、调试器和诊
系统 2019-08-12 01:32:21 2316
1.表:人事档案HrgeneralCREATETABLE[dbo].[Hrgeneral]([hrcode][varchar](50)NOTNULL,--员工工号[hrname][varchar](16)NULL,--员工姓名[oldName][varchar](50)NULL,--曾用名[CardNo][varchar](50)NULL,--考虑对应的IC卡号码[ID][varchar](22)NULL,--身份证号码[birthday][datetim
系统 2019-08-12 01:32:06 2316
1.适当的空格逻辑行首的空白表示逻辑表示层次关系从而决定分组语句从新行的第一列开始风格统一都用四个空格不能随便加空格奥运五环#绘制奥运五环importturtleturtle.width(10)turtle.color("blue")turtle.circle(50)turtle.penup()turtle.goto(120,0)turtle.pendown()turtle.color("black")turtle.circle(50)turtle.pen
系统 2019-09-27 17:56:36 2315
1.数据库中创建stream以及视图CREATEFOREIGNTABLEt_error_log(err_datedate,hostnamevarchar(128),err_timetimestampwithouttimezone,db_uservarchar(128),db_namevarchar(128),client_addrvarchar(128),log_levelvarchar(128),err_logvarchar)serverpipeline
系统 2019-09-27 17:55:20 2315
原文链接:http://blog.fenlanli.com/articles/2019/08/20/1566293147402.htmlMysql配置修改配置文件:sudovim/etc/mysql/my.cnf,避免插入数据时出现内存表isfull的错误。添加如下内容:[mysqld]#避免内存表iffull,自行设置max_heap_table_size=4096M重启mysql服务:sudoservicemysqlrestart创建数据表创建一个商品
系统 2019-09-27 17:53:43 2315
简述一开始觉得这个很有趣,然后就想来做一个来玩一下使用语言:Python3使用工具:opencv视频监控+socket数据传输技术程序检验:这里我考虑了一下,发现还是没有必要实现封装成可执行文件。还是直接就放代码吧。(先放代码,以后再做解释)本程序,经过本人修改,保证可以使用使用要求:Sender代码必须要在一台有摄像头的电脑上运行起来。然后把数据编码,压缩之后,再传给另外一个电脑Reciever作为接受端,没什么特别的要求。两个电脑都必须要按转好nump
系统 2019-09-27 17:51:47 2315